Aaron Edwards, co-founder of KiraGen Bio, shares his journey from a Harvard Business School project to pioneering a multi-edit CAR T-cell therapy for solid tumors. He discusses tackling immune suppression in glioblastoma, leveraging machine learning, and the challenges of fundraising. Edwards emphasizes the importance of discipline, innovative design strategies, and authentic leadership in the biotech space. His insights offer a fresh perspective on overcoming the complexities of brain cancer treatment while navigating the startup landscape.

ADVICE

Focus On Milestones, Not Science For Science

  • Run lean and focus on milestones that directly advance your goal of clinical progress.
  • Avoid scientific distractions that don’t move the company towards patient impact quickly.
ANECDOTE

Early Company Building Experience

  • Early company building involved limited funding, setting up a minimal lab in a shared academic space, and opportunistic hiring.
  • Team members who trusted each other from past collaborations enabled efficient lab and business operations.
INSIGHT

ML Rationalizes Complex Edits

  • Machine learning is used not just for screening but to rationalize design decisions and reduce costly wet lab permutations.
  • This technology could eventually enable democratized partnerships and service platforms in cell therapy development.
